Turkiye February 2025: Toyota up to record #2, places Corolla Sedan in the lead
The Toyota Corolla Sedan is the best-selling vehicle in Turkiye in February.
90,730 new light vehicles found a new Turkish home in February, a -14.4% decline on a record February 2024. This month is however still the 2nd best February in Turkish history. The year-to-date tally is now off 159,384, also the 2nd highest in history. Renault (-23.9%) remains the favourite carmaker in the country despite a harsh year-on-year drop. Toyota (+43.8%) is up a further three spots on January to #2 and 10.3% share vs. #9 over the Full Year 2024. This the Japanese brand’s highest ranking and share ever, beating its previous best of #3 and 9.8% in January 2021. Fiat (-48.3%) is in total freefall at #4 with Volkswagen (-8.4%) rounding out the Top 5. Hyundai (+7.6%) defies the negative market at #6. In contrast with the rest of the world, the performance of the month is delivered by Tesla going from 0 sale in January to 3,310 and 3.6% share this month, cracking the Top 10 for the first time at #9. These are new ranking, volume and share records for the brand, eclipsing its previous best of #14 and 2.8% in September 2024 and 2,670 in June 2024. Note it is possible that January and February sales are combined together. BYD (+1074.1%) continues to gear up but drops three spots on January to #10.
Over in the Passenger Cars models ranking, the Toyota Corolla Sedan (+5%) snaps the top spot with 6% share, distancing the Renault Clio (-30.3%) down one rank to #2. The Tesla Model Y shoots up to #3 ahead of the Fiat Egea Sedan (-28.8%) and Renault Megane Sedan (-29.8%) both posting atrocious performances. The Toyota C-HR (+306%) quadruples its year-ago volume and ascends to #6, even ranking #5 year-to-date vs. #31 over the Full Year 2024. Hero of last month, the BYD Seal U falls two spots to a still outstanding #7. Local EV Togg T10X (+104.2%) is still among the Turkish best-sellers. Hyundai has the i20 up 28.4% to #10 and the Bayon up 17.9% to #12.
